Description

The Siemens 6AV7615-0AE32-0AG0 is a SIMATIC Panel PC 670, an industrial panel computer designed for human-machine interface (HMI) and control applications. This unit features a 15-inch TFT display, a Pentium III 500 MHz CPU, 256 MB of RAM, and a 40 GB hard drive. It operates on a 24 V DC power supply and comes pre-installed with Windows 2000 in a multi-language configuration (English, German, French, Italian, Spanish), making it suitable for diverse industrial environments requiring robust and reliable computing.

Installation Guidelines

  1. De-energize System: Ensure all power to the installation area is disconnected and locked out before beginning any work.
  2. Mounting: Securely mount the Panel PC into a suitable control cabinet or panel cutout, ensuring adequate ventilation space around the unit.
  3. Power Connection: Connect the 24 V DC power supply to the designated terminals, observing correct polarity. Verify the power source meets the specified voltage requirements.
  4. Grounding: Establish a proper protective earth (PE) connection to the Panel PC chassis for safety and electromagnetic compatibility.
  5. Peripheral Connections: Connect any necessary peripherals such as keyboards, mice, or external storage devices to the available ports.
  6. Network Connection: If required, connect the industrial Ethernet or other communication cables to the appropriate interfaces.
  7. Power Up: After all connections are verified, re-energize the system and observe the Panel PC for proper startup and operation.
